SEOUL March 21 (Yonhap) -- On the 21st, KBS announced the launch of a global idol debut project.

Scheduled to premiere in May, KBS 2TV's "MA1" will feature 36 multinational participants competing towards their dream of becoming idols.

Unlike typical idol survival shows where trainees from agencies participate, "MA1" will feature boys who were leading ordinary lives without agency affiliations.

The vocal coaching team will be led by singers Lim Han Byul and Kim Sung Eun, while the dance coaching team will consist of Vata and Ingyoo from the group We Dem Boyz, and Hanhae as the rap coach.


Mamamoo's leader, Solar, will also support the participants in blossoming their potential, and each episode will feature various artists as "special coaches."
